We signed Digne for £18mil and he played roughly 3 seasons for us before extending his deal.
So £18mil ÷ 5 (his contract) = £3.6mil
£3.6mil × 2 (years remaining) = £7.2mil.
He then signed a 4 year extension so the £7.2mil ÷ 4 (length of contract) = £1.8mil.
Lets call it 3.5 years left (as i cant be bothered to calculate too much as he extended mid season) which would be £6.3mil.
So, if we sell Digne for £25mil we cover the £6.3mil = £18.7mil.
We can spend that amount all in January. This means we can sign players and spread the fee over the length of the players contract.
In theory we could sign players totalling £18.7mil × 5 = £93.5mil
The only caveat here is that for the next 4 summers we would continue to pay £18.7mil a summer after the first payment of £18.7mil.
